### Runbook: TemplateForge render latency

If your plugin's templates render slowly, first confirm the compiled-template cache is warm: cold compiles dominate p99 in most reports. Check that your partials are not invalidating the cache on every request via dynamic names, and that loop bodies avoid per-iteration helper lookups. Before filing a report, capture the host's rendering configuration; the relevant values are listed below.

settings of bawif-fawif:
ralix:
  log_level: warn
  metrics_host: metrics.ralix.tolvaqsys.internal
  pool_size: 32

To: Dispatch Desk
Subject: Replacement courier — archive consignment

Following yesterday's missed pick-up by Larkspan Transit, the consignment of bound ledgers for the Orrelby records annex has been reassigned to Midvale Couriers. Collection is now scheduled for Thursday at 09:00 from the records room. The manifest and seals remain unchanged. The records team should note the following for the hand-over.

courier memo of yawep-yafog: the pramir ulaix courier leaves the ulavan aldix frair zorok oliiel joreth rusdor fenvan ledger at gate 1305 under passcode 514738

- [ ] **Verify sorting stability in the Marlowe report builder before sealing the ceremony record.** As reviewer, confirm that multi-column sorts in Marlowe use the stable comparator introduced in the Ashgrove patch, so rows with equal keys keep their original order across regenerated reports. Run the fixture suite twice and diff the outputs; any reordering fails the check. Once the diff is clean, initial the checklist and countersign the ceremony log. To decrypt the log for countersigning, use the recovery passphrase recorded just below.

strongbox words: ralys-quenion-quenael-norok-zorvan

**Where did the mail room go?** Good question — it moved last month from the ground floor of Tarnwell House up to Level 2, next to the print hub. Post trolleys now come up via the service corridor, so don't wait by the old hatch. Outgoing mail cut-off is still 15:30. The new room stays locked outside collection times, so team assistants should use the door code below.

turnstile pass: bdg-FVNQRS-72965873